This article has been formally retracted following an editorial investigation that identified serious violations of research and publication ethics. The investigation found that the article contained materially false and unverifiable data that compromised the validity and reliability of its findings. It was also established that one or more individuals had been listed as authors or contributors without their knowledge, authorization, or explicit consent. Such unauthorized attribution constitutes a serious breach of authorship standards and prevents the journal from establishing legitimate responsibility for the article’s content. Because these issues affect the integrity of the article in its entirety, correction or partial amendment would be insufficient.
The Editor and Publisher have therefore decided to retract the article from the scholarly record. The original article will remain accessible solely for transparency and archival purposes, with each version clearly marked as “Retracted.” Readers are advised not to cite, rely upon, or use the article’s data, findings, or conclusions.
